Karachi: Senior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) leader Asad Umer said on Sunday that the PTI would defeat all parties in the upcoming local elections in Karachi. He told that disappointment had been pervasive and the country would rise again after the elections in 2023 when Imran Khan would be prime minister again. He also alleged that the thieves were imposed on the country and the country was being looted.
